What it is
A document analysis tool that reads research papers, reports, and academic sources, then generates summaries with properly formatted citations. Built as a wrapper on GPT-4 with added citation-formatting capabilities for APA, MLA, and Chicago styles. The audience pulling 90K monthly visits skews toward graduate students, academic researchers, and policy analysts who need source-backed analysis rather than general document chat.

Sharly is an AI-powered research tool that extracts key insights from research documents with verified citations. It allows users to upload PDFs, DOCX, PPTX, and Notion files to get structured summaries, cross-document validation, and team collaboration features. The platform is designed for researchers, analysts, and teams who need to efficiently process dense research documents and transform them into actionable insights.
Yes, Sharly offers a free tier that includes 5 documents per day and 50 messages per month, along with basic summaries and multi-format uploads. Paid plans start at $12.50 per month for the Pro plan (billed yearly) with unlimited uploads and advanced features. Team plans are $24 per month per seat, and Enterprise Business plans offer custom pricing.
Sharly supports APA, MLA, and Chicago citation formats. The platform includes a citation management system that allows users to hover over any insight to view and verify the original source. This makes it particularly useful for academic research and professional analysis where proper citation is critical.
Yes, Sharly includes collaborative features such as shared workspaces, team annotations, and inline feedback systems. The Team plan ($24 per month per seat) specifically includes team annotations, knowledge retention, and analytics for up to 100 users. This makes it suitable for research teams, analysts, and labs working across multiple documents.
Sharly supports multiple file formats including PDF, DOCX, PPTX, and Notion files. The platform also integrates with Google Drive, Notion, and Dropbox for easy document access. Once uploaded, Sharly's AI engine automatically generates summaries, key insights, and structured highlights within seconds.
Sharly includes a 'docs-only' reasoning mode that restricts AI responses to uploaded documents only, ensuring research integrity by preventing hallucination or external information contamination. The platform also provides cross-document validation to identify patterns, conflicts, and missing information across your document library. All insights come with verifiable sources that users can trace back to the original documents.
Yes, Sharly provides end-to-end encryption with AES-256 at rest and TLS 1.3 in transit, making it suitable for sensitive research environments. The Enterprise Business plan includes additional security features like SSO/SAML integration and admin dashboards. The platform is designed to handle confidential research documents with enterprise-grade security protocols.
